Transaction 4c499999eef789875ed40e1998205e8da71b3313069a684557e88498135f2ca2
2 Input
2 Outputs
- 4c499999eef789875ed40e1998205e8da71b3313069a684557e88498135f2ca2:0
- 4c499999eef789875ed40e1998205e8da71b3313069a684557e88498135f2ca2:1
value 5784000
address 15it8U3cNs5SwZwTN61Hvfuz2cPq2VpqbX
value 35922410
address 17muHyyNQhrVThMpqHuNr5eYuaRDJMcv9Q